Mildred A. Hoag

March 26, 1907 — June 15, 2004

Mildred Angot Brandvik was born March 26, 1907, to Christ and Clara (Hawkins) Brandvik, in Harwood, ND, where she grew up and attended school. Mildred graduated from Fargo Central High School, Fargo, ND.
Mildred was united in marriage to Veeder Hoag, April 10, 1929, in Moorhead, MN, and they lived and farmed in the Harwood area until 1958. They later farmed near Argusville, ND, and then on the Brandvik farm by Harwood. The couple moved to Mayville, ND, in 1972, and to Fargo in 1980.
Veeder preceded Mildred in death on June 23, 1989. Mildred continued to make her home in Fargo and entered Villa Maria, Fargo, in March of 2002. With her family by her side, Mildred went to be with her Lord on Tuesday, June 15, 2004, in MeritCare Hospital Palliative Care Unit, Fargo, at ninety-seven years of age.
Mildred is lovingly survived by her two daughters, Virginia Vleck and her husband, Walter, Buxton, ND, and Marilyn Gunnarson and her husband, Marvin, Havre, MT; daughter-in-law, Alice Hoag, Moorhead; fourteen grandchildren: Milton Hoag Jr., Virginia (Hoag) Demmer, Pam (Hoag) Guest, Tom Hoag, Tim Hoag, Roxanna (Hoag) Lauinger, Gloria (Vleck) Schneider, John Vleck, Wayne Vleck, Phyllis (Vleck) Dapper, Daryl Gunnarson, Dean Gunnarson, Dennis Gunnarson, and Susan (Gunnarson) Hanger; thirty-six great-grandchildren; four great-great-grandchildren; sister-in-law, Dorothy Hoag, Minneapolis, MN; brother-in-law, Lev Hoag, Duluth, MN; and many cousins.
In addition to her husband, Mildred was preceded in death by her son, Milton; a daughter, Phyllis; a grandson, Dicky; a great-grandson, Tyler; a brother, Clarence; a sister, Lillian Stanley; and a twin sister, Myrtle Bennett.
